Postgraduate Certificate in Psychology of Death
-- ViewingNowThe Postgraduate Certificate in Psychology of Death is a comprehensive course that delves into the human experience of death and dying. This course is essential for professionals working in hospice care, therapy, social work, and counseling, as it provides a deeper understanding of the emotional, social, and psychological aspects of death and grief.
